FAQs about Casco Bay Hotel Portland Airport - Maine Mall, an Ascend Collection Hotel

Is parking available at the hotel?

Yes, the hotel offers free on-site parking for guests.


What type of breakfast is offered and what are the serving hours?

A complimentary continental breakfast is served daily from 6:30 AM to 9:30 AM.


What are the check-in and check-out times?

Check-in is at 3:00 PM and check-out is at 11:00 AM. Early or late check-in/check-out may be available upon request.


Are airport shuttle services available?

Yes, a complimentary roundtrip airport shuttle service is available 24 hours. Guests must contact the hotel with arrival details to arrange the transfer.

What accessibility features does the hotel offer?

The hotel features elevators and step-free entrances, ensuring accessibility for guests with disabilities.


Where is the hotel located in relation to local attractions?

The hotel is located in a shopping district, just a 1-minute drive from Maine Mall and 8 minutes from Thompson's Point. It is approximately 12.4 miles from Old Orchard Beach Pier and 4.5 km from Portland Intl. Jetport Airport.


What are the hotel's policies regarding children?

Up to 3 children aged 18 years and younger can stay free when occupying the parent or guardian's room, using existing bedding.


Does the hotel offer extra beds or cribs?

The hotel offers rollaway beds for a fee of USD 10.00 per day. Advance request or confirmation may be required.
